Output 103e470b4f599548506a9503723657d3ee352ee8e8075c4831e421d24852b4ea:12

value
16223852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8615cb44873f3992b598f08c144f0220488055c OP_EQUAL
address
3QLL8xSw2JfiYGB6EQRJ7X3K7WyJPY2CTz
transaction
103e470b4f599548506a9503723657d3ee352ee8e8075c4831e421d24852b4ea
spent
true